NYK and YLK Jointly Hold Seminar for National Staff from Offices around the World

JOC Staff |

From October 7 to 11, Nippon Yusen Kaisha (NYK; head office: Chiyoda-ku,
Tokyo; president: Yusumi Kudo) and Yusen Logistics Co., Ltd. (YLK; head
office: Minato-ku, Tokyo; president: Hiromitsu Kuramoto) jointly conducted
their 2013 Global NYK/YLK Week, a training seminar targeting NYK and YLK
national staff from around the world. Twenty-eight staff members ? 14 from
NYK and 14 from YLK ? were selected from the Group’s global business bases
to attend the seminar.

The seminar was held in Tokyo and Kyoto and aimed to foster a sense of
solidarity among the Group members by promoting mutual understanding across
national, company, and divisional boundaries. Since last year, the seminar
has been jointly organized by NYK and YLK, aiming to further strengthen
linkages and networks within the Group.

This year’s seminar was held under the theme, 塗ichWhat will be the key
challenges for the NYK Group over the next five years?罵och Participants
actively exchanged opinions during various programs designed to deepen
understanding of the business and initiatives of the NYK Group. The
programs included discussions on the NYK Group values of integrity,
innovation, and intensity; lectures on each divisional strategy based on
the medium-term management plan; and workshops focusing on quality and
workplace skills that are the basis of the Group’s competitiveness. The
participants were divided into five groups, and each group made a
presentation about the seminar’s theme. This raised members’ consciousness
of the importance of active participation in the Group’s business
management.

Moreover, to promote better understanding of Japanese culture, the members
visited various cultural sites and took part in Zen meditation in Kyoto.
